• europages
  • >
  • COMPANIES - SUPPLIERS - SERVICE PROVIDERS
  • >
  • emblem

Results for

Emblem

United KingdomEast of EnglandManufacturer/producer
  1. STRESS BALLS

    United Kingdom

    We are one of the leading providers of stress toys, stress balls, stress relievers and other branded promotional products. Get your name out there and let people know about your company with your logo on the best promotional merchandise in the market.

Filters

Results for

Emblem

Number of results

1 Company